Operating Voltage Range:200 V to 500 V
Output Current Capacity:6/16 A
Field Supply Compatibility:Up to 500 V line voltage
Protection Features:Overvoltage protection included
Power Supply Options:DCS-FEX-1 or 2 field supply
Environmental Conditions:Operates in temperatures from -25°C to +50°C
